Flathead second at Tri-State tournament

| December 21, 2008 1:00 AM

The Daily Inter Lake

COEUR D'ALENE, Idaho - Ten placers and 186 1/2 points' the Flathead Braves wrestling team proved its status among the Northwest's best with a second-place finish Saturday at the 34-team Tri-State tournament.

"This is the team we've been waiting to see. We already knew they had this potential," said Flathead coach Matt Owen.

"It's the best performance they've had up to this point of the season. We're definitely excited about it. It was a fun tournament."

Lake Stevens, last year's runner-up, is the 2008 Tri-State champion. It and Flathead were the class of the tournament. Lake Stevens scored 206 1/2 points and the Braves were just 20 points behind. Deer Park, Wash. was a distant third at 145 points. Polson scored 34 points.

But the Braves pushed Lake Stevens hard.

"We didn't put in as many finalists as they did, but we had more placers," Owen said.

Flathead trailed Lake Stevens by just six points going into the championship round. But Lake Stevens had four finalists and three of them won. Both of Flathead's finalists - Shawn Lau and Tyler Thomas - finished second.

"Neither one was happy about the result, but they both wrestled well," Owen said.

Others who placed for the Braves were Ryan Swelland, fifth at 112, Alejandro Calderon, fifth at 119, Joaquin Calderon, fifth at 125, Tanner Beaman, third at 130, Caleb Allen-Schmid, fifth at 145, Ryan Thiel, seventh at 145, Bryce Stacy, third at 152 and Connor Thomas, sixth at heavyweight.

"A couple of them were a little disappointed. They had high goals and didn't quite reach them," Owen siad.

"We still see a lot of places we can improve. But it definitely shows us we were a lot better than what we have been doing. They can see they're starting to improve. I think it's definitely a really positive tournament," he added.

The Braves are heading out Saturday to the Sierra-Nevada Classic in Reno, Nev. They will compete Dec. 29-30 against more than 90 teams.

"We were just happy with the result. It would have been nice to win it, but we did pretty well."
